The homes in Westbury range from mid-century colonials to modern ranch-style houses, and most rely on either oil-fired heating systems or gas furnaces. Both depend heavily on proper chimney and venting function to operate safely and efficiently. When a flue becomes blocked by creosote buildup, animal debris, or winter ice accumulation, your heating appliance can't vent properly. Modern systems have safety switches that shut them down rather than let dangerous gases back into your living space. Westbury residents deal with some of the harshest weather on Long Island. Winter temperatures regularly dip below freezing from October through March, and the combination of cold nights and morning frost creates ideal conditions for flue blockages and draft failure. Ice can form inside chimney flues when warm air escapes from your heating system. Creosote buildup thickens in cold weather and becomes more likely to partially obstruct airflow. Dampers that haven't been operated in months can seize up in the cold. Any of these scenarios will trigger a shutdown, and you'll find yourself without heat when you need it most. Oil heat is particularly common among homes in Westbury and the surrounding Nassau County area. Oil burners are efficient and reliable when properly maintained, but they're also sensitive to venting issues. An oil burner will lock out if it detects a draft problem, a blocked vent, or improper air supply. When that happens, you can't just hit a restart button and hope for the best. The system needs to be inspected, the obstruction cleared or the problem diagnosed, and the burner reset safely. The geography of Westbury puts it close enough to Long Island Sound and coastal water bodies that humidity and salt air can accelerate corrosion in chimney and vent systems. Metal flue pipes degrade faster in humid, salty environments. Exterior chimney walls can deteriorate, affecting the integrity of the flue.
